MQTT Homie Error

@David_Graeff

I am seeing this in the log for a Homie device. System was working fine and then this just popped up. Using MQTT Explorer the Homie device is online and working just fine. Any thoughts?

2019-12-26 15:28:32.281 [hingStatusInfoChangedEvent] - 'mqtt:homie300:Queen:scene-54703' changed from ONLINE to OFFLINE (COMMUNICATION_ERROR): The connection object has not been set. start() should have been called!

How often are you seeing this and have you tried changing the logs to TRACE or DEBUG if error is frequent?

This was the first time - I had to restart OH to make it go away. It’s critical error as all Homie devices went offline when the error occurred.

MQTT experienced a few changes in the time of Nov to Dec and a few continuous integration tests that would catch errors had to be disabled. Please keep observing the log and if possible fill a bug report on Github.

Cheers, David

I had the same problem today so I filed an issue on Github.